Signs That Indicate It’s Time For Remodeling The Kitchen

Are you really happy or just really comfortable?

When it comes to the kitchen, a homeowner chooses comfort over happiness. If you are comfortable with the layout of the kitchen, you may not want to change it. But, remember that you must pay attention to the kitchen because it is the heart of your home.

If the kitchen is old and dingy, it can attract the growth of mold and mildew. Also, an old kitchen with a broken countertop or damaged cabinets can cause injury to your family members. As a homeowner, if you are unable to make a decision about remodeling the kitchen, do not worry. Here are a couple of signs that will indicate it is time to take care of the kitchen:

There is no Use of Existing Appliances

Do you have kitchen appliances that you no longer use? It is important to remember that appliances take up the maximum amount of space. And, if there are several appliances that do not function properly, it is time to discard them. You should also make a list of the appliances that do not satisfy your needs completely. For example, if the size of your family has increased, your old microwave will not ...
... be sufficient to defrost a large turkey or a chicken.

When the appliances start restricting your cooking experience, it is time for remodeling the kitchen. By upgrading the kitchen and buying modern appliances, you will be able to reduce the energy bill as well as decrease excess consumption of water.

The kitchen is crowded

Technology has invaded the kitchen space. Today, a homeowner uses several kitchen appliances that were non-existent a few years ago. As a result, old kitchens have become crowded. If you find that the kitchen counter-top and the dining table is covered with kitchen appliances, dinner plates, glasses, cooking pots etc., start thinking of hiring a renovation contractor.

If you hire an experienced contractor, he will able to suggest you with modern ideas for increasing space in the kitchen. Ask him to make optimum use of the free space by adding more cabinets in the kitchen.

It is Uncomfortable for Family Members

With the increasing number of family members, the need for a large kitchen increases. If you are going to get married in the near future or expecting a child, it is best to consider the requirements of new family members. If the kitchen is not suitable for a large family, do not think of buying a new home. Simply consider remodeling the kitchen to increase its space.

When you have small children in your home, it is best to baby-proof the kitchen. Ask the renovation contractor to build sturdy cabinets that do not cause any injury to small children. He will address your safety concerns effectively and build kitchen cabinets keeping the safety of your children in mind.

It is time to sell your Home

Are you interested in selling your home? If your answer is yes, it is essential that you upgrade the kitchen. If you think that remodeling the kitchen is a waste of time and money, remember that roomy, well-lit and modern kitchen is important for every home buyer. A dull kitchen will not fetch you a good price. So, it is wise to invest in upgrading the kitchen.

By remodeling the kitchen, you will be able to show the kitchen space in new light. The renovation contractor will take care of faulty plumbing as well paint the kitchen walls beautifully. If you are putting your home on sale, it is essential that you discuss simple remodeling ideas with the contractor. Do not opt for highly-customized ideas because potential home buyers may not like them. Instead, choose simple and elegant ideas that will make the kitchen look beautiful.

A kitchen is an important part of every household. But, homeowners ignore it because they consider remodeling it as an expensive and unnecessary task. If you ignore it, you will have to spend money on expensive repairs in the future. So, it is necessary to look for signs that indicate the need for remodeling the kitchen.
